The Swedish Armed Forces K9 Unit is Hiring a Facility Caretaker

About the Position

The Swedish Armed Forces K9 Unit (FHTE) is part of the Air Combat School (LSS) and breeds and trains service dogs for search and patrol duties. FHTE is tasked with developing the K9 service and providing the Armed Forces' combat units with dogs that meet the high standards set by the Armed Forces. Together with dog handlers, the service dogs are trained for missions in the war organization, both nationally and internationally.

We are currently seeking a Facility Caretaker to be based at FHTE in Sigtuna/Märsta.

Information about the Swedish Armed Forces and the Recruiting Unit:

The Air Combat School is the Air Force's joint competence center for development and training. The Air Combat School has four joint Air Force schools and trains, among other things, future pilots within the Armed Forces. The Air Combat School operates at seven locations spread across the country and has its headquarters in Uppsala.

Employment with us means placement in a security class. Usually, Swedish citizenship is required. A security clearance with a background check will be conducted before employment according to Chapter 3 of the Security Protection Act. Employment also includes an obligation to be placed in a war situation. The implications of this vary depending on the type of position.
